Today we explore the biblical narrative of Jesus walking on water to illustrate how divine grace meets human struggle and spiritual exhaustion (Mark 6:30-52). The author reinterprets the "hardened hearts" of the disciples not as a moral failure, but as a defensive condition caused by an inability to recognize God's true character amidst trauma and fear. By connecting the miracle of the loaves to the storm, the source suggests that spiritual blindness often stems from past wounds that make unconditional kindness seem unrecognizable or threatening. Ultimately, the passage offers a compassionate perspective for survivors of spiritual abuse, emphasizing that Jesus provides his presence and safety before demanding full understanding. This "slow grace" reveals a God who patiently enters the chaos of life to heal those who have been hardened by religious harm.
